Temperance Future: Upright & Reversed Meaning of Flow, Healing, and Transformation
Temperance card is a visual representation of balance, moderation, and harmony. With its depiction often featuring an angel pouring liquid between two cups, it suggests the blending of energies and the integration of opposites. When applied to future predictions, Temperance holds valuable insights into the potential for balanced and harmonious outcomes.
